Embedded Nano Relay for Intra-Body Network-Based Molecular Communications
نویسندگان
چکیده
Abstract We propose an embedded synthetic relay transport protein (RTP) approach for communication between the external environment (blood vessels) and internal targeted nanonetworks (cells/tissues) within intra-body network. In fact, we designed a bioengineered protein-based facilitated diffusing to be alternative in case of biological proteins (such as channels, e.g. Pores) failing. The proposed is inspired by traditional wireless system-based concept, which nanodevices known donor, relay, acceptor bionanomachine construct molecular system.
